[CSHARP-2174] Use a single solution and set of project files to multi target .NET Framework and .NET Standard Created: 05/Feb/18  Updated: 29/Oct/19  Resolved: 13/Dec/18

Status: Closed
Project: C# Driver
Component/s: Build
Affects Version/s: 2.5
Fix Version/s: 2.8.0

Type: Improvement Priority: Major - P3
Reporter: Robert Stam Assignee: Robert Stam
Resolution: Done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Depends
depends on CSHARP-2400 Build Nuget packages from .csproj fil... Closed
is depended on by CSHARP-2220 ISupportInitialize ignored on some ve... Closed
is depended on by CSHARP-2393 Driver is not compatible with .NET 4.7.1 Closed
is depended on by CSHARP-2391 Provide an overload for JsonWriter.Wr... Backlog
is depended on by CSHARP-2033 Update dependency on System.Runtime.I... Closed
is depended on by CSHARP-2439 Update how AssemblyInfo properties ar... Closed
is depended on by CSHARP-2100 Upgrade package dependencies Closed
Related
related to CSHARP-2404 Upgrade target from net45 to net452 Closed
is related to CSHARP-2248 Synchronize JSON driven test files be... Closed
is related to CSHARP-2411 Fix TestReplace on .NET Core 2.1 Backlog
is related to CSHARP-2412 Fix SelectQuery tests on .NET Core2.1 Backlog
is related to CSHARP-2400 Build Nuget packages from .csproj fil... Closed
Epic Link: Build/CI (Phase 1)

 Description   

We currently have two solution files and two sets of project files, one to target .NET Framework and the other to target .NET Standard.

We should be able to use a single solution file and set of project files and configure the projects to target multiple frameworks.



 Comments   
Comment by Githook User [ 13/Dec/18 ]

Author:

{'username': 'rstam', 'email': 'robert@robertstam.org', 'name': 'rstam'}

Message: CSHARP-2174: Use a single solution and set of project files to multi target .NET Framework and .NET Standard.
Branch: master
https://github.com/mongodb/mongo-csharp-driver/commit/3b807e658c1459682ebecd12bf3e4e57884ef741

Comment by Robert Stam [ 20/Nov/18 ]

Blocked until the other related tickets are done and we can merge them to master all at once.

Comment by Vincent Kam (Inactive) [ 12/Oct/18 ]

Transitioning back to "In Progress" due to evergeen image issues

Generated at Wed Feb 07 21:41:48 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.